Comprehending Your House's Solar Power Potential
How can homeowners determine their solar potential? Determining solar potential begins with examining roof orientation and angle. Ideally, a south-facing roof with a slope between 15 and 40 degrees increases exposure to sunlight. Homeowners should also consider shading from nearby trees, buildings, or structures, as any obstruction can significantly reduce solar energy capture.
Next, they can assess local climate data to identify the average sunlight hours per day. Zones with higher sunlight availability will naturally have superior solar potential. Moreover, homeowners may leverage online solar calculators, which factor in geographical location and roof specifications to provide an estimate of potential solar output.
Lastly, seeking advice from a professional solar installer can offer valuable insights, including property evaluations and personalized recommendations. By implementing these steps, homeowners can effectively gauge their property's suitability for solar panel installation, paving the way for informed decision-making regarding renewable energy investment.

Comparing Monocrystalline and Polycrystalline
When homeowners evaluate solar panel solutions, comprehending the differences between monocrystalline and polycrystalline panels remains essential for making an informed determination. Monocrystalline panels, made from single-crystal silicon, are recognized for their superior efficiency and sleek appearance. They typically utilize less space, making them ideal for rooftops with limited room. In contrast, polycrystalline panels are made up of multiple silicon crystals and are generally less efficient, but they offer a lower cost. This affordability may benefit budget-conscious homeowners. Both types have their strengths and cons, including factors like temperature tolerance and longevity. Ultimately, the preference between monocrystalline and polycrystalline panels is based on individual needs, available space, and financial considerations.
Solar Panels with Thin-Film Technology
Whereas monocrystalline and polycrystalline panels lead the solar industry, thin-film solar panels provide a unique alternative that deserves consideration. These panels are made by depositing photovoltaic material onto a substrate, creating a lightweight and flexible design. This flexibility enables easier installation on irregular surfaces and integration into building materials. Thin-film panels generally have a lower efficiency when measured against their crystalline counterparts but can operate better in low-light conditions and high temperatures. Moreover, they require less material, which may lead to a lower environmental impact during production. However, homeowners should be aware that thin-film technology usually has a shorter lifespan and may require more space to generate the same electricity output. Examining these factors is essential for informed decision-making.
Determining Installation Costs and Creating a Budget
Calculating expenses and planning budgets for solar panel installation calls for careful consideration of several factors that can determine overall expenses. Homeowners should first assess the size of the system essential, which is typically based on energy consumption and roof space. The type of solar panels selected—monocrystalline, polycrystalline, or thin-film—can also significantly affect costs. In addition, installation expenses can differ based on the intricacy of the roof and local labor rates.
Required permits and inspections also add to the total budget. Property owners must also consider expenses for inverters, mounting equipment, and electrical wiring. It is advisable to obtain multiple quotes from reputable installers to verify competitive pricing. Lastly, accounting for possible upkeep expenses assists in developing a comprehensive budget aligned with future energy cost reduction objectives. Overall, a detailed cost estimation process will aid homeowners in making informed decisions regarding solar panel installation.
Understanding Financial Advantages and Rebates
Homeowners can dramatically minimize the financial burden of solar panel installation by examining linked resource various financial incentives and rebates available at the federal, state, and local levels. At the federal level, the Investment Tax Credit (ITC) lets homeowners to deduct a substantial percentage of their solar installation costs from their federal taxes. Many states offer additional incentives, such as cash rebates, tax credits, and performance-based incentives, which additionally reduce the overall cost of installation. Local utility companies may also deliver rebates or net metering programs that credit homeowners for excess energy generated by their solar systems. Moreover, some municipalities have specific programs designed to promoting renewable energy, which can include grants or low-interest financing options. By carefully researching these opportunities, homeowners can maximize their savings and make solar energy more financially feasible. Engaging with local solar organizations can also provide valuable insights into available programs and eligibility requirements.

Preparing Your Home for Installation
Ahead of the installation of solar panels can start, it is important to verify that the home is properly prepared for the process. Homeowners should commence by inspecting the roof's condition, confirming it is structurally sound and free of damage. Any needed repairs should be done prior to installation to prevent complications later. In addition, the roof should be free from obstructions such as large trees or chimneys that may cast shadows on the panels.
Subsequently, homeowners should assess their electrical system to confirm compatibility with the new solar setup. This may require consulting an electrician to ensure that the existing wiring can handle the additional load. Furthermore, securing any needed permits or approvals from local authorities is crucial to ensure compliance with regulations. Lastly, homeowners should clear the installation area, ensuring easy access for the installation team and reducing potential delays. Proper preparation sets the stage for a smooth and streamlined solar panel installation.
Maintaining Your Solar Panel System
While solar panels are engineered to be low-maintenance, regular upkeep is necessary to maintain optimal performance and longevity. Homeowners should begin by routinely inspecting their solar panels for dirt, debris, or any shading that may obstruct sunlight absorption. A simple rinse with water can often be adequate for cleaning, though professional services are advisable for stubborn grime or difficult-to-access areas.
In addition, checking the performance of the system through the inverter can aid in detecting potential issues early. Property owners should also verify for any noticeable damage to the panels, mounting systems, or electrical wiring. It is recommended to have a qualified technician conduct a detailed examination at least annually to validate the system operates efficiently.
Last but not least, ensuring trees well-maintained and ensuring that surrounding structures do not obstruct sunlight will boost energy generation. By implementing these maintenance routines, homeowners can get the most from their solar panel investment and contribute positively to energy savings.

How Long Does Solar Panel Installation Typically Take?
Generally, solar panel installation takes one to three days, contingent upon the system size and complexity. Factors such as weather, permit procedures, and the experience of the installation team may also influence the entire duration.
Am I Able to Install Solar Panels Myself?
Installing solar panels oneself is possible, but it requires extensive technical knowledge, tools, and conformity to local regulations. Many homeowners opt for professional installation to guarantee safety, efficiency, and compliance with legal standards.
What Takes Place if My Solar Panels Create Too Much Power?
When solar panels generate excess energy, homeowners can receive credits from their utility company through net metering. This surplus can offset future electricity costs, enabling them to save money while promoting sustainable energy practices.
Do Solar Panels Work Effectively in Cloudy or Rainy Climates?
Solar panels remain effective in overcast or wet climates, as they utilize indirect sunlight. Although energy output may reduce, they can still deliver sufficient power output, making them a feasible solution for different weather patterns.
How Do I Know if My Roof Is Suitable for Solar Panels?
To assess roof suitability for solar panels, you need to examine roof orientation, angle, shading from nearby trees or structures, age, and structural integrity. Consulting a professional installer can provide a complete evaluation and recommendations.
